I think a better word is "handle" videos instead of "manipulate".


So, it was said that there's only one option of plugin right now (MPEG) for cross-platform. Considering that my application will run only with windows systems, is there any way to work with AVI and WMV formats as well?

I'm pretty sure that Sophie handles that. Just try:

Open MPEGMoviePlayer and click on the menu. There should be some options there.
Convert a mpeg movie or a folder of pictures.
